Vascular Ultrasound Technologist
Job Posting: Vascular Ultrasound Technologist
Job Description
Discover Vein And Vascular Center is excited to announce the availability of a career opportunity for a Vascular Ultrasound Technologist in our dedicated East Valley Vascular practice. We are currently seeking a highly motivated and experienced individual to fill this Full-Time position. Please note, this is not a remote job and the selected candidate will be required to work on-site with our team of healthcare professionals.
This role suits a dynamic technologist proficient in performing vascular and other ultrasound examinations, ensuring the quality and consistency of clinical data, and enhancing patient care. The ideal candidate will join a team committed to outstanding patient outcomes and ongoing professional development.
Duties and Responsibilities
- Perform vascular ultrasound procedures including but not limited to carotid, venous, arterial (upper and lower extremity), and aorta examinations.
- Assess patients, provide education on the procedure, and ensure comfort and safety at all times.
- Interpret and document ultrasound data, reporting critical findings to physicians promptly.
- Maintain ultrasound equipment, troubleshoot issues, and ensure compliance with industry standards and safety regulations.
- Collaborate with the healthcare team to optimize patient treatment plans based on ultrasound findings.
- Assist in scheduling and confirming appointments, maintaining clear and effective communication with patients.
- Stay updated with the latest technologies and techniques in vascular ultrasound through continued education and professional growth opportunities.
- Ensure the confidentiality and rights of all patient information, adhering to all HIPAA regulations.
- Participate in quality assurance procedures to continually improve the quality and efficiency of ultrasound operations.
Requirements
- Formal Ultrasound Technologist Certification from an accredited institution.
- At least 5 years of experience as a Vascular Ultrasound Technologist.
- Proficiency in performing ELG/Mesenteric, Renal & Dialysis fistula procedures preferred.
- Minimum of 2 years of vascular experience, including venous reflux testing.
- Expertise in carotid, arterial (upper & lower extremity) including arterial bypass, venous testing (upper & lower extremity) including venous reflux testing & Aorta examinations (including bypass).
- Registered Vascular Technologist (RVT) certification is a plus.
- Demonstrated ability to provide excellent patient care with a customer service mindset for each and every patient.
- Strong work ethic, positive attitude, and ability to multitask effectively within a fast-paced environment.
- Prior experience working in a vascular surgery practice will be advantageous.
